India's beauty market, valued at over $50 billion, continues to outpace many consumer categories, yet nail care remains largely unbranded and fragmented. This gap presents a sizable opportunity for focused players that can combine product quality with cultural relevance. Nailinit’s entry aligns with a broader shift toward niche beauty segments, where consumers seek specialized, expressive solutions rather than generic offerings. By positioning itself at the intersection of self‑expression, community, and convenience, the brand taps into a latent demand that larger incumbents have largely ignored.
The rapid rise of quick‑commerce platforms such as Zepto, Blinkit and Instamart has reshaped how Indian shoppers acquire beauty products. Nailinit’s early traction on these services, alongside its presence on Amazon, demonstrates an omnichannel strategy that leverages low‑friction delivery to bypass traditional salon visits. This distribution model not only accelerates customer acquisition but also generates real‑time data on preferences, enabling agile product iteration. The pre‑seed capital will fund deeper integration with these platforms and expand direct‑to‑consumer channels, reinforcing a feedback loop that fuels both brand loyalty and innovation.
Investor enthusiasm for Nailinit reflects a growing appetite for consumer‑focused startups that marry technology‑enabled distribution with community‑driven branding. The involvement of GCCF, Marsshot VC, and high‑profile angels signals confidence that niche beauty brands can achieve scalable growth without relying on massive advertising spends. As more founders adopt culture‑centric narratives and leverage quick‑commerce ecosystems, the sector is likely to see heightened competition and rapid product diversification, ultimately raising the overall standard and accessibility of beauty care across India.
